The Electronics Manufacturing Case for Structural Oil-Free Air

In electronics manufacturing — PCB assembly, SMT pick-and-place, component cleaning, and conformal coating — compressed air contacts product surfaces directly. Oil vapour in the compressed air supply, even at concentrations below ISO Class 1 limits, can deposit on PCB copper traces and component pads, causing solder balling, flux activation failure, and adhesion defects that manifest as field failures rather than production-line rejects. The cost of tracing a field failure back to compressed air contamination — in warranty claims, diagnostic labour, and reputational damage — vastly exceeds the cost differential between oil-injected and oil-free compression technology.

The EP-CM11BF eliminates this risk at the source. Water lubrication produces no oil that can enter the compressed air stream under any operating condition. ISO 8573-1 Class 0 certification verified by Germany TUV covers oil content, particulates, and moisture — providing the documentation required for electronics manufacturing quality audits without reliance on downstream filter condition.

Key Features

35% More Output Than Entry Level

The step from 7.5 kW to 11 kW delivers approximately 35% more free air delivery at 0.8 MPa — from 1.15 m³/min to 1.55 m³/min — while maintaining the identical 58 dB(A) noise level and ISO 8573-1 Class 0 air quality. This increment covers the gap between single-instrument supply and small multi-user installations.

0.8–1.25 MPa Pressure Range

The full pressure range accommodates diverse application requirements from a single machine: standard laboratory and dental supply at 0.5–0.8 MPa, pharmaceutical processing at 0.7–0.8 MPa, and higher-pressure precision spray coating or tool driving at 1.0–1.25 MPa. Pressure setpoint is adjustable via the PLC controller.

58 dB(A) — Quiet Across Full Output

Maintaining 58 dB(A) at 11 kW output requires the specific noise characteristics of the single-screw water-lubricated design: no belt drive, no gear train, no valve clatter, and the inherent smoothness of the orbital compression cycle. The acoustic enclosure and CMN-patented intake structure complete the noise management system.

Zero Oil Condensate

No oil enters the compression circuit, so no oil-contaminated condensate is produced. There is no oil-water separator to install, maintain, or replace. For facilities under ISO 14001 environmental management certification, elimination of compressor oil waste streams simplifies compliance documentation and reduces hazardous waste audit scope.

Direct-Drive Permanent Magnet Motor

The 11 kW motor is direct-coupled to the air end — no belt, no coupling, no transmission loss. IP54 environmental protection and Class F insulation allow installation in light industrial environments with moderate dust and humidity levels. Motor efficiency is 3–5% above standard asynchronous alternatives.

Stainless Steel Throughout

Air end housing, water circuit pipework, air-water separation barrel, and outlet connections are all stainless steel. Rust, scale, and metallic particle contamination are structurally eliminated — meeting the zero-particulate requirements of pharmaceutical GMP, semiconductor fabrication, and precision optics manufacturing.

Frequently Asked Questions

How does the EP-CM11BF differ from the EP-CM08BF?
The EP-CM11BF delivers up to 1.55 m³/min at 0.8 MPa — approximately 35% more free air delivery than the EP-CM08BF — while maintaining the same 58 dB(A) noise level, identical air quality (ISO 8573-1 Class 0), and the same compact installation footprint. It is the natural step up for applications where the EP-CM08BF's output is borderline or insufficient.
Is the EP-CM11BF suitable for electronics PCB manufacturing?
Yes. The structural Class 0 oil-free air guarantee eliminates the risk of oil vapour contamination of PCB surfaces during compressed air cleaning, SMT pick-and-place operation, and reflow oven nitrogen assist. Oil traces on PCB surfaces cause soldering defects and component adhesion failures that are extremely costly to detect and rectify after assembly.
Can the EP-CM11BF supply multiple instruments or workstations simultaneously?
At 1.55 m³/min (55 cfm) peak output, the EP-CM11BF can supply multiple simultaneous users: several laboratory analytical instruments, three to five dental treatment chairs, or two to three light assembly workstations. The exact number depends on each user's air consumption rate and duty cycle.
What pressure can the EP-CM11BF achieve?
The EP-CM11BF covers the full 0.8–1.25 MPa working pressure range, adjustable via the PLC controller. This range accommodates applications from standard laboratory instrument supply at 0.5–0.8 MPa through to higher-pressure tool driving and precision spray coating at 1.0–1.25 MPa from a single machine.
